Broadcom DRVLin-LPe-UG120-100
4
Emulex Drivers for Linux for LightPulse Adapters User Guide
2.2.3.1 vPort sysfs Tree....................................................................................................................................26
2.2.3.2 vPort sysfs Entries ................................................................................................................................27
2.2.4 Monitoring vPorts with fc_vport.......................................................................................................................29
2.2.5 vPort Configuration Limits ...............................................................................................................................29
2.3 Ethernet Driver Configuration for PPC CNAs.......................................................................................................30
2.3.1 Ethernet Driver Configuration Parameters......................................................................................................30
2.3.2 Support for Ethtool set-channels/get-channels Commands............................................................................30
2.3.3 Support for Ethtool set-dump Command ........................................................................................................31
2.3.4 Transmit/Receive Queue Counts....................................................................................................................31
2.3.5 Support for Ethtool set-rxfh/get-rxfh Commands ............................................................................................32
2.3.6 Support for Showing Onboard Die Temperature ............................................................................................32
2.3.7 SR-IOV Configuration .....................................................................................................................................32
2.3.7.1 Introduction ...........................................................................................................................................32
2.3.7.2 Setting Up SR-IOV................................................................................................................................33
2.3.7.3 Assigning VFs to a VM on the SLES Operating System ......................................................................36
2.3.7.4 Link State Reporting with SR-IOV ........................................................................................................37
2.3.7.5 Configuring VFs ....................................................................................................................................37
2.3.7.6 Link State Configuration .......................................................................................................................39
2.3.7.7 Spoof Check Configuration...................................................................................................................39
2.3.7.8 Viewing VF Properties ..........................................................................................................................39
2.3.8 Bonding Considerations..................................................................................................................................39
2.4 FC and FCoE Driver Performance Tuning ............................................................................................................40
2.4.1 Overview .........................................................................................................................................................40
2.4.1.1 lpfc_fcp_io_channel ..............................................................................................................................40
2.4.1.2 lpfc_fcp_io_sched .................................................................................................................................40
2.4.1.3 lpfc_fcp_imax........................................................................................................................................41
2.4.1.4 lpfc_vector_map.sh...............................................................................................................................41
2.5 Network Performance Tuning ................................................................................................................................42
2.5.1 Memory Bandwidth Considerations ................................................................................................................42
2.5.1.1 Enabling Optimal Bandwidth Options ...................................................................................................42
2.5.1.2 Populating DIMM Slots ..................................
.......................................................................................42
2.5.1.3 Disabling Memory Mirroring..................................................................................................................42
2.5.1.4 Using a Fast Clock Speed for the Front Side Bus (FSB)......................................................................42
2.5.2 Network Memory Limits ..................................................................................................................................42
2.5.3 TCP Segmentation Offload (TSO) ..................................................................................................................43
2.5.4 Flow Control....................................................................................................................................................43
2.5.5 RX Frame Coalescing.....................................................................................................................................44
2.5.6 Maximum Transmission Unit (MTU) ...............................................................................................................44
2.5.7 Interrupt Coalescing ........................................................................................................................................45
2.5.7.1 Setting the Interrupt Delay Duration to a Range of Values (AIC) .........................................................45